European Gas & Power (EGP) is part of bp's trading business based in Canary Wharf, London. It is front and centre in bp's plans to move away from Oil to a future of renewable energy. The gas business is a crucial element of this transition providing base load capacity and the ability to meet peak demand, while the power business is investing heavily in wind and solar. Their power strategy includes reaching 12GW of renewable power by 2030; which equates to one third of the UK's total current demand.

What you need to be successful:
- Broad hands-on experience of supporting, implementing and extending features in Openlink Endur.
- Hands on and in-depth experience of Endur's C# Open Component API, Open JVS, UDSRs, Report Builder, Operation Services and Services Manager (Grid Architecture).
- Excellent and demonstrable Oracle SQL skills.
- Deep experience of Endur's main modules including:
- APM (e.g. new page creation, understanding of exposure)
- Trading Explorer (e.g. deal modelling/capture, templates, expo/PnL results)
- Market Explorer (e.g. curve and volatility setup, market data analysis)
- Admin & Reference Manager (static data, location and pipelines, valuation pools)
- Services Manager (e.g. task and workflow creation)
